Hyperthyroidism may ... WebFollowing surgery, you may experience: Voice changes, such as, a hoarse voice, difficulty in speaking loudly, voice fatigue, and a change in the tone of your voice. These changes are due to damage to the laryngeal nerves that supply your voice box (larynx) during surgery. This may last a few days or a few weeks but is rarely permanent.

WebAug 12, 2024 · Most people can go home within 1 day of thyroid removal. Full recovery from surgery usually takes a few weeks. With a few adjustments, most people live just as they did before thyroid removal. You’ll need lifelong medication to stay healthy after the removal of most or all of your thyroid. WebThe overall mean cost of outpatient thyroidectomy was $5617, with a mean cost of same-day surgery of $4642 compared with $6101 for overnight observation (P < .0001). When stratifying by extent of thyroidectomy, the cost of same-day surgery was consistently lower than that for overnight observation.
